Understanding the Core Principles of Responsible Wagering
Responsible wagering isn’t just about avoiding losses; it’s about cultivating a healthy and sustainable relationship with betting. It requires a disciplined approach, setting clear boundaries, and recognizing the inherent risks involved. A fundamental principle is to only wager with funds you can afford to lose, treating it as a form of entertainment rather than a source of income. Effective bankroll management is also essential, dividing your funds into smaller units and avoiding chasing losses. This prevents impulsive decisions and protects against significant financial setbacks. Furthermore, understanding the statistical probabilities associated with different betting markets can greatly improve your decision-making process and contribute to a more rational approach.
The importance of research cannot be overstated. Before placing any wager, take the time to gather information about the teams or individuals involved, analyze their recent performance, and consider any relevant factors that could influence the outcome. This proactive approach transforms betting from a game of chance into a more informed and strategic pursuit. However, it's also vital to acknowledge that no amount of research can guarantee success, and luck will always play a role. Maintaining a realistic perspective and accepting the possibility of losses are integral components of responsible wagering. The Role of Platform Features in Promoting Responsibility
A well-designed platform will actively promote responsible gaming through a variety of features. Deposit limits allow users to control the amount of money they can add to their account, preventing overspending. Loss limits similarly restrict the amount of money a player can lose within a specified timeframe. Self-exclusion options offer a more drastic measure, allowing individuals to voluntarily ban themselves from the platform for a period of time. These features empower users to take control of their betting habits and mitigate potential risks. Furthermore, access to detailed betting histories and account statements provides valuable insights into spending patterns, enabling users to identify any potentially problematic behavior. Transparency and user-friendly tools are hallmarks of a responsible platform.
Beyond individual controls, reputable platforms will also offer access to resources for problem gambling support. This may include links to external organizations, self-assessment tools, and educational materials on responsible gaming. Proactive communication, such as reminders to take breaks or warnings about excessive betting activity, can also be effective in promoting awareness and preventing harm. A commitment to responsible gaming isn’t simply a matter of compliance; it's a demonstration of ethical conduct and a genuine concern for the well-being of users. It's a feature any discerning bettor should carefully consider when selecting a site.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Deposit Limits | Allows users to set a maximum amount of money they can deposit within a given period. |
| Loss Limits | Restricts the amount of money a user can lose over a specific timeframe. |
| Self-Exclusion | Enables users to voluntarily ban themselves from the platform for a set duration. |
| Betting History | Provides a detailed record of all bets placed, allowing users to track their spending. |

Understanding Margin and its Impact on Returns
The margin, also known as the ‘vig’ or ‘juice’, represents the platform’s commission on each bet. It’s the difference between the true odds of an event occurring and the odds offered by the platform. A lower margin translates into better odds for the bettor, while a higher margin reduces potential payouts. For example, a margin of 5% means the platform retains 5% of every wager placed. While seemingly small, this percentage can accumulate over time, significantly impacting your overall returns. Experienced bettors often prioritize platforms with low margins, as they recognize the long-term benefits of maximizing their payouts.
Comparing margins across different platforms can be challenging, as they are often not explicitly displayed. However, you can estimate the margin by calculating the implied probability of an event occurring based on the odds offered. The lower the implied probability compared to the actual probability, the higher the margin. Tools are available online that can automate this calculation. Always consider the margin when evaluating betting platforms, and choose those that offer the most competitive rates. Doing so can substantially improve your profitability over time.

Evaluating Platform Security and User Experience
In the digital age, security is paramount. A reputable wagering platform must employ robust security measures to protect user data and financial transactions. This includes utilizing advanced enc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to safeguard sensitive information during transmission. Two-factor authentication adds an extra layer of security, requiring users to verify their identity through a second method, such as a code sent to their mobile device. Regular security audits by independent third-party firms provide assurance that the platform’s security protocols are up to date and effective. Furthermore, the platform should be licensed and regulated by a reputable gaming authority, ensuring compliance with industry standards.
However, security is only one aspect of a positive user experience. The platform should also be user-friendly, intuitive, and easy to navigate. A clean and uncluttered interface, clear labeling, and efficient search functionality are essential. Mobile compatibility is also crucial, allowing users to access the platform on their smartphones and tablets. Responsive customer support is another key element, providing prompt and helpful assistance when needed. Multiple channels of communication, such as live chat, email, and phone support, offer flexibility and convenience. A seamless and enjoyable user experience enhances engagement and fosters customer loyalty.
The Importance of Licensing and Regulation
Licensing and regulation are critical indicators of a platform’s legitimacy and trustworthiness. Reputable gaming auth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ission, impose strict standards on platforms operating under their jurisdiction. These standards cover areas such as security, fairness, responsible gaming, and anti-money laundering. Platforms that are licensed and regulated are subject to regular inspections and audits, ensuring compliance with these standards. This provides a level of protection for users, assuring them that the platform is operating ethically and responsibly.
Before signing up for any wagering platform, it’s essential to verify its licensing status. This information is typically displayed prominently on the platform’s website. You can also check with the relevant gaming authority to confirm the validity of the license. Avoid platforms that are not licensed or regulated, as they may pose a higher risk of fraud or unfair practices. Choosing a licensed and regulated platform is a fundamental step in protecting your funds and ensuring a safe and enjoyable wagering experience.

Beyond the Basics: Exploring Advanced Features and Innovations
The online wagering landscape is constantly evolving, with platforms continually introducing new features and innovations to enhance the user experience. Live streaming of sporting events allows users to watch the action unfold in real-time, adding excitement and providing valuable insights for in-play betting. Cash-out options provide the flexibility to settle your bet before the event has concluded, locking in a profit or minimizing potential losses. Personalized betting recommendations, powered by artificial intelligence, can help users discover new markets and identify potentially lucrative opportunities. These advanced features cater to the evolving needs and preferences of modern bettors.
Furthermore, the integration of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ies holds immense potential for transforming the wagering experience. VR could create immersive virtual environments where users can experience the thrill of being at the event itself, while AR could overlay real-time data and statistics onto the live action. The development of blockchain-based wagering platforms offers increased transparency and security, utilizing decentralized technology to ensure fair and verifiable outcomes. These innovations represent the cutting edge of the wagering industry and are likely to shape its future.
The Evolving Landscape of Data Analytics in Sports Wagering
The integration of advanced data analytics is significantly reshaping the ways individuals approach sports wagering. Previously reliant on gut feelings and simple statistics, today’s bettor has access to an unprecedented wealth of information. Sophisticated algorithms can now analyze player performance metrics, team strategies, historical data, and even external factors like weather conditions to generate predictive models. These models aren’t infallible, but they provide a data-driven foundation for making more informed decisions compared to purely intuitive approaches.
Moreover, this trend is not limited to large-scale operations. Increasingly, tools and resources are becoming available to individual bettors, allowing them to leverage data analytics in their own wagering strategies. These typically involve subscribing to data feeds, utilizing specialized software, or accessing platforms that offer curated insights. The ability to identify undervalued opportunities, assess risk more accurately, and ultimately improve decision-making is becoming increasingly reliant on the effective use of data. The future of successful wagering will undoubtedly be characterized by a synergy between human intuition and data-driven analytics.
